Meet Our Podiatry Team

Southern Podiatry Clinic Nowra has a team of foot specialists providing high quality podiatry services to Nowra and the Shoalhaven.

Christine Watson

Dip.Pod.NSW.

Christine studied podiatry in Sydney, graduating in 1995. After working both in the private and public systems around the Illawarra she finally settled in the Shoalhaven with her husband Andrew to purchase Southern Podiatry Clinic Nowra in mid 1997.

With over 24 years of practising all facets of podiatry she has developed a special passion for chronic disease (such as diabetes, rheumatoid and osteoarthritis etc) and geriatric foot care in order to help maintain a client's independence through comfort and mobility.

Christine loves living in the Shoalhaven where she has been lucky to raise her two children with Andrew. In her spare time she loves spending time with family and friends, standup paddle boarding, cooking and playing with her gorgeous miniature schnauzer "Evie".


Andrew Watson

Dip.Pod.NSW.

Andrew graduated his Podiatry studies in Sydney in 1995 and soon settled in the Shoalhaven region in 1996. He soon developed a love of the coastal lifestyle especially fishing.

Andrew has great experience in all facets of Podiatry practice including general foot care, diabetic assessment, nail surgery, biomechanical assessment and prescription orthotic therapy. He is continually improving his knowledge and skills by regularly attending educational courses.

Andrew enjoys the challenges of working in private practice and working with a multidisciplinary team. He also cherishes the relationships he has built over the years with his patients.

Andrew and his wife Christine together have been building their family practice for the last 24 years.

Brett MacCue

BPodMed MAPodA.

Brett moved to Nowra in 2013 after serving in the Australian Army for seven years with the Royal Australian Engineers. Brett graduated with a Bachelor of Podiatric Medicine from Charles Sturt University. Brett has experience working in high risk diabetic foot care, nail surgery, biomechanics, orthotic therapy and in general footcare


Brett is a member of the Australian Podiatry Association and the Australasian Academy of Podiatric Sport. He has completed further post graduate training in dry needling and taping. Brett's goal is to enable people to maintain their lifestyle whilst recovering from an injury. When not at work, Brett can be found spending time with his daughter Millie.
